Output 3a073dc3882837b238d5f8c9fcecd73f0b7c486797aa03d1c5e4e3950294e211:23

value
51833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ff1b439dd73bd374d8953372be9d86f39744c04 OP_EQUAL
address
339KcJwRiyBVdu6vsjRrtFnfufAHeNWTnt
transaction
3a073dc3882837b238d5f8c9fcecd73f0b7c486797aa03d1c5e4e3950294e211
confirmations
203699
spent
true